    Hi Friends,

    The other day my taskbar (which I keep on top of screen) doubled itself and started putting long icons of the pages I have open. I can have 8-9 pages open at a time and this really goofed things up for my searching etc.. It also brought my Gadwin Screen Shot up to the top when I normally keep it on the bottom. Please not that this is not the icon but the work bar that shows up when I open the program.

    I have no idea what I hit but I hit something, and I don't like the taskbar taking up so much real estate on the top of my screen. I have the setting on small icons and checked to see if it still was, and it still is.

    Go to Taskbar properties. In the "Taskbar buttons:" selection box choose - "Always combine, hide labels"

    I did as you suggested and did have to check "Always combine icons but when I checked the task bar I had no change. Then I tried the simplest thing I could have and didn't think of because it was too easy. I put the mouse on the bottom of the bar and pushed up. Done deal, all fixed, years ago I would have just done this right away. I also would have know to re-lock the Taskbar when working with it. This getting old stuff is for the birds.
